DATA SHEET
The Most Cost-Effective Way to Build a SAN
The QLogic 5600Q lets you start small, then scale with your company’s
needs using state-of-the-art 10Gb Fibre Channel “stacking” technology
typically found only in high-end director products. As proven in the
Ethernet world, stackable architectures cut costs and increase stability
by providing a dedicated, highly-expandable transport for aggregate ISL
traffic—eliminating the disruption, port waste, and management hassles
associated with the use of regular device ports as ISLs. It’s like having the
performance and hands-off convenience of an expensive chassis switch
without the overhead cost of a chassis!
Need more server or storage ports? Simply add another 5000 Series Switch to
the stack. There’s no need to move existing cables or disrupt devices—your ISL
bandwidth expands automatically with each switch!
Affordable Now—Big Savings Later
Low initial cost—Out of the box, dual-speed QLogic 5600Q Series
products provide superior performance at a price-per-port that is
competitive with single-speed, non-stacking edge switches.
Reduced expansion costs—With no device ports wasted on ISLs,
multiswitch QLogic 5600Q networks require up to 50 percent fewer
switches. As your SAN grows, the cables and transceivers required for
QLogic 5600Q 10Gb ISLs actually cost less per gigabit of bandwidth
than using 4Gb ISLs.
Longer product and topology lifespan—Other vendors force
customers to take a non-linear “rip and replace” approach to SAN
growth, offering a limited solution at the low end, followed by a radically
different (and much more expensive) architecture as the installation
matures. QLogic’s modular ISL backbone helps customers pace
investments and deployment activities predictably over time, with
fewer wrong turns and reversals—even when corporate strategies and
directions change. The QLogic 5600Q ensures that every SAN purchase
remains a viable part of the infrastructure far into the future.
More Ways to Grow
Flexible port licensing on a single switch—QLogic 5600Q products
are available in a range of port-count configurations. As requirements
change, it’s easy to activate additional ports in four-port increments
using the embedded QuickTools interface or the command line interface.
